15th MILITARY INTELLIGENCE BATTALION
COAT OF ARMS
Shield: Azure, above a base rayonne argent, a winged
sphinx couchant of the last and in chief two plates
partially superimposed fesswise the conjoined area
sable.
Crest: None approved.
Motto: VIGILANTIA AD FINEM (VIGILANCE TO
THE END).
Symbolism: Oriental blue and silver gray are the
colors used for military intelligence. The winged
sphinx, all-seeing and continually watchful, refers to
the battalion™s air reconnaissance support mission and
also connotes the unit's motto. The overlapping discs
simulate camera lenses and allude to the stereoscopic
capabilities provided by the organization in its perfor-
mance of reproduction, identification, and packaging of
aerial imagery. The flames are indicative of heat
sensory devices, wisdom, and zeal.
DISTINCTIVE UNIT INSIGNIA
The distinctive unit insignia is the shield and motto of
the coat of arms.
LINEAGE RA (active)
- Constituted 6 January 1966 in the Regular Army as the 15th Military Intelligence Battalion. Activated 25 February 1966 at Fort Bragg, North Carolina. Inactivated 30 April 1972 at Fort Bragg, North Carolina.
- Activated 21 April 1978 at Fort Hood, Texas (Detachments A, B, C, and D concurrently consolidated to form Company A; 131st Military Intelligence Company [see ANNEX I] and 156th Army Security Agency Company [see ANNEX 2] reorganized and redesignated as Companies B and C).
- Headquarters and Headquarters Company inactivated 31 May 1981 at Hunter Army Airfield, Georgia (Company C concurrently inactivated at Fort Bliss, Texas). (Company A inactivated 15 April 1982 at Fort Hood, Texas; disbanded 15 September 1983. Company B reorganized and redesignated 16 September 1983 as Company A; Company C concurrently redesignated as Company B.)
- Headquarters and Headquarters Company redesignated 16 October 1985 as Headquarters, Headquarters and Service Company and activated at Fort Hood, Texas (Company B concurrently activated).
ANNEX 1
- Constituted 1 July 1971 in the Regular Army as the
131st Military Intelligence Company and activated in
Vietnam.
ANNEX 2
- Constituted 1 June 1966 in the Regular Army as the
156th Aviation Company and activated in Vietnam.
- Converted and redesignated 5 November 1973 as the
156th Army Security Agency Company
CAMPAIGN PARTICIPATION CREDIT
Southwest Asia
- Defense of Saudi Arabia
- Liberation and Defense of Kuwait
Company A additionally entitled to:
Vietnam
- Consolidation I
- Consolidation II
- Cease-Fire

DECORATIONS
- Meritorious Unit Commendation (Army), Streamer
embroidered SOUTHWEST ASIA (15th Military
Intelligence Battalion cited; DA GO 12, 1994)
Company B additionally entitled to:
- Meritorious Unit Commendation (Army), Streamer
embroidered VIETNAM 1966-1967 (156th Aviation
Company cited; DA GO 17, 1968, as amended by DA
GO 1, 1969)
- Meritorious Unit Commendation (Army), Streamer
embroidered VIETNAM 1967-1969 (156th Aviation
Company cited; DA GO 2, 1971)
- Meritorious Unit Commendation (Army), Streamer
embroidered VIETNAM 1971-1972 (156th Aviation
Company cited; DA GO 32, 1973)
- Republic of Vietnam Cross of Gallantry with Palm,
Streamer embroidered VIETNAM 1970-1971 (156th
Aviation Company cited; DA GO 6, 1974)
